Document Title :
Development of a Cross-Platform Artificial Neural Network Component for Intelligent Systems

Abstract : In recent years, cross-platform application development has become a major issue in the area of information systems technology. Modeling and design tools have been developed for multiple platforms due to their potential capability in many environments. Unified Modeling Language (UML), as an example, combines all stages of application development life cycle, and generates cross-platform codes using object-oriented methodology. Artificial Neural Networks (ANNs) have been adapted extensively for solving a wide range of problems efficiently. Nowadays, systems need to be developed within the shortest possible time because of the competence in the market. Therefore, one needs a quicker way of embedding ANNs into Software Development Life Cycles on multiple platforms. This approach requires a cross-platform ANN tool. This paper describes a component that is suitable for UML environment and discusses some of its features. Finally, two case studies are presented in order to illustrate the usefulness of the suggested component.
